here are some more things about that:
They don’t have teeth or jaws *in their mouths*, so the most common starfish feeding method is to simply cover their prey, usually a clam or a snail or something else very slow, and flip their own stomach inside-out to smother and digest the prey externally.
I specify “in their mouths” because in some starfish the entire body surface is blanketed in extremely tiny jaw-like structures, sometimes thousands of them. These can be purely defensive or they can be a means of making the starfish “sticky” to small prey such as shrimp.
While most sea stars simply rely on eating things slower than themselves – sometimes including healthy, but sleeping fish – there are also stars who form an ambush trap ike this. Small animals try to hide under this nice cave and then the starfish clamps down on them to do the stomach trick.
Also this isn’t related to them killing things but most sea stars have fully functioning eyes, almost invisibly tiny, at the end of each arm.

Reminder NOT to use (un)scented lotions, topical medications, scented candles, incense, or essential oil diffusers on or around your pets unless instructed otherwise by your vet. If using a lotion or a medication, don’t touch your pet or anything your pet interacts with before washing your hands and letting the affected area dry.
Fumes from scented lotions and air fresheners can seriously irritate pets’ lungs. Because of the difference in lung structure and function, even one-time exposure can be potentially lethal for birds specifically. (x, x, x) This is because birds’ lungs push more oxygen (and any airborne toxins) into the bloodstream per breath, making the same concentrations of fumes more dangerous for birds than humans. Cats and dogs can have adverse reactions to some essential oils and air fresheners if they already have sensitive airways, (x), and can be even more dangerous if your pet drinks or eats the materials.
An open flame is also a terrible idea to have around any curious animal. Even if it’s ‘out of reach’, a determined animal will find a way. It’s easier not to give them the option. That’s just common sense.
If even a little cream gets on their skin, medicinal or not, it could cause a reaction, especially in animals with thin skin like parrots and amphibians. Regardless the toughness of their skin, most animalsWILL ingest it when they groom themselves.
The smallest amounts of zinc oxide (found in sun block, calamine lotion, rash creams, US pennies made after 1982, all metal zippers, some paints, and many rubber products, among other things) can cause vomiting and diarrhea in cats and dogs, sometimes to the point of internal bleeding. (x) In birds it can cause regurgitation, lameness, mental aberrations, and sudden death depending on the species (x), with exposure ranging from a few days to a few years.
Human medications are plenty dangerous for other reasons, and I’d list the risks if this post weren’t already so long. Instead, you can read about some of them here (x).
As a general rule: if you’re unsure about something, DON’T EXPOSE YOUR PET TO IT. Always talk to your vet first. If it can hurt a person at all, imagine what it could do to something smaller.
